Subject: ORM cut-over complete — Thornvale billing

Hi on-call,

The legacy ORM layer in Thornvale billing was swapped for the new mapper at 02:10. All write paths now go through the unit-of-work wrapper; the old session factory is stubbed but still present for one more sprint. If you see duplicate-insert alerts, roll back via the feature flag rather than redeploying. The replacement service starts with the configuration values below.

settings of bawif-fawif:
ralix:
  log_level: warn
  metrics_host: metrics.ralix.tolvaqsys.internal
  pool_size: 32

Finance Review Summary — Q3 Inventory Write-Down

Sales leads: Morventi Ltd has booked a 1.8M write-down on unsold Kestrelline units held at the Dorvast warehouse. Aging stock exceeded 14 months; resale channels failed to clear it. Margin impact hits Q3 only. Do not discount remaining Kestrelline stock below floor pricing without finance sign-off. Forecast accuracy from regional teams must improve; submissions are now monthly. Further write-downs are possible if Q4 sell-through stalls. The strategic context for this decision is noted below.

board note of bawep-tajef: Queniusek Systems plans to raise the Quenvan list price by 53.1 percent in March. The pricing group signed off on a budget of $176.4 million for Project Drueth. The renewal with Casionix Partners closes at $142.5 million a year, 8.3 percent below the last contract. Project Fraax slips by six weeks because of the tooling delay.

Onboarding note for the Ledgerpane admin table: bulk edits are applied through the batcher service, not directly against the database. Select rows, choose an action, and the batcher stages changes in a pending set you can review before commit. Edits over 500 rows require a second approver — this is enforced server-side, so don't try to chunk around it. To run the batcher locally you need the staging write credential, which goes in your .env as the next line.

secret setting of bahip-kagag: RELAY_SECRET3=c83

## Service Accounts — StormFan Alert Fan-Out

The fan-out worker authenticates to the internal dispatch tier using the svc-stormfan account. Rotate quarterly; scopes are limited to publish-only on alert topics. If deliveries stall during your shift, verify the worker is using the current credential, reproduced below for reference.

API key for kaweg-hahif: kto4_rAjZ